Output 074d3579050458425a8d13d02ef87d2604ef598c1c16893f053665c84b5a136c:0

value
2398652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ab58b62eccd9e00ee8a2869f7b9ee28996fb4e OP_EQUAL
address
MCcMxaYX1DR2qykJBYHxhPTaPnUtTRazsw
transaction
074d3579050458425a8d13d02ef87d2604ef598c1c16893f053665c84b5a136c
spent
true